The service models you are most likely to encounter

When comparing solar business Yuba City home owners will typically see several kinds of providers.

A real regional installer handles sales, design, permitting, and installation under one roof covering or with a small routine staff. This version can create strong liability due to the fact that the person who offered the work commonly recognizes the person monitoring the mount. It can additionally indicate better responsiveness after the system is activated. The trade-off is capacity. A small group may have much longer lead times in peak season.

A regional installer covers several Northern California markets and might have a stronger back office, a lot more buying power, and more standard procedures. These companies can be an excellent middle ground if they still preserve neighborhood field groups and solution support.

A nationwide brand name commonly has very refined financing, broad advertising reach, and well-known devices bundles. Some carry out quite possibly. Others rely heavily on subcontractors, which can make responsibility murkier if something goes wrong.

Then there are sales companies that do not mount in any way. They generate leads, close contracts, and pass tasks to third-party installers. This configuration is not inherently bad, but it creates a layer between the house owner and the people doing the job. If you are dealing with one of these firms, you need to recognize exactly who will make, allow, mount, and service the system.

A good solar quote should really feel certain, not generic

One of the fastest means to judge solar firms is to check out just how details their proposition is. A major quote must show your roof, your historical power usage, and your objectives. It must not look like the same layout sent to every home in town.

The strongest propositions generally describe approximated annual manufacturing, not just system size. They determine panel and inverter brand names and design lines. They keep in mind whether the layout utilizes string inverters, microinverters, or optimizers, and why. They attend to roof covering condition if there are issues. They explain whether monitoring is included. They discuss what assumptions are constructed right into the cost savings projection.

Watch for quotes that focus practically totally on regular monthly repayment language. "No cash down" and "less than your energy costs" are insufficient. A financed system can still be overpriced, and a low monthly number can hide a long-term, a high supplier charge, or unrealistic presumptions about future utility rates. The mathematics requires to function past the sales pitch.

If a service provider can not clearly answer how they sized the system, just how much of your usage they anticipate to offset, or why they chose particular devices, maintain looking.

Roof problem, electric upgrades, and other information that can derail a project

Three concerns stall solar projects more frequently than homeowners expect: roofing age, electrical infrastructure, and shading.

Roof age issues because solar ought to not be installed on a roofing nearing completion of its life. Getting rid of and re-installing panels later on includes cost and aggravation. If your roofing system may require substitute within the next a number of years, address that before solar, or deal with a company that can collaborate both scopes cleanly. This is one area where some roofing-focused solar firms can be especially useful.

Electrical facilities issues because older homes sometimes need a major panel upgrade, a subpanel adjustment, or other electric work to sustain the system securely and legitimately. A major supplier must recognize this possibility very early as opposed to unexpected you after contract signing.

Shading issues due to the fact that manufacturing price quotes can turn dramatically based on trees, nearby frameworks, and roofing geometry. Also partial color at the wrong time of day can impact system outcome, particularly relying on inverter style. A mindful design accounts for that. A careless style assumes full sun and wishes you never ever contrast the quote to the real production.

These details do not make a company poor if they emerge. What issues is whether the firm explores them early and connects clearly concerning alternatives and costs.

Warranties are only like the company behind them

Solar customers usually find out about lengthy equipment warranties, sometimes 20 to 25 years depending upon the element. Those work, however they do not answer every inquiry that matters.

Panel producers guarantee one thing. Inverter producers may service warranty another. The installer's craftsmanship guarantee is different. Roofing system infiltration protection may have its own language. Labor for substitute may or might not be included under all situations. If a problem happens, who works with the claim? Who pays for troubleshooting? That routines the solution browse through? How long does that usually take?

This is where stable regional assistance matters. Also solid equipment can fail periodically. When it does, the home owner desires a receptive point of contact. A business that has real solution capacity in the location can be worth a somewhat greater rate. A firm that vanishes right into voicemail after final payment is not.

When contrasting solar carriers, request for the service warranty terms in writing, then read how solution is really handled. Created assurances issue. So does the probability of getting an actual person on the phone 2 years later.

What is the 120 rule for solar panels in Yuba City?

The 120% rule is an electrical code provision used when connecting solar to certain existing electrical panels. In a common application, the main breaker rating plus the solar breaker rating cannot exceed 120% of the panel busbar rating when specific connection requirements are met. The calculation helps prevent the electrical panel from being overloaded. Actual system design must follow the electrical code provisions applicable to the installation.
